When compiling with:
./configure --disable-set-vars --disable-examples --disable-scheduling

I get following error:
./libgecodeflatzinc.so: undefined reference to  
`Gecode::cumulatives(Gecode::Space&, Gecode::PrimArgArray<int> const&,  
Gecode::IntVarArgs const&, Gecode::IntVarArgs const&, Gecode::IntVarArgs  
const&, Gecode::IntVarArgs const&, Gecode::PrimArgArray<int> const&, bool,  
Gecode::IntConLevel)'
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
make[1]: *** [tools/flatzinc/fz] Error 1


This does not occur when removing --disable-scheduling from the configure  
script.

> we are releasing the next version of Gecode.
>
>                   Gecode 3.2.0
>            http://www.gecode.org
>
> This release has some important bug fixes (in particular for
> global cardinality aka count), the documentation has been
> improved (worked around some issues with generation by doxygen),
> integrates the FlatZinc interpreter into the Gecode source tree,
> provides propagators for disjunctive scheduling (experimental),
> and lots of small changes and fixes. For more consistent names,
> branchings are branchers now and branching descriptions are
> choices (this you might have to adapt to).
>
> On our web site, you find source packages, as well as binary packages
> for Windows and Mac OS.
